cara membuat kalkulator dengan menggunakan software delphi



ketentuan gambar :




penjelasan : {harap melihat nama caption atau text nya:spt button,edit..text}


procedure TForm1.Button10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'0';
end;

procedure TForm1.Button11Click(Sender: TObject);
var a,b,c:integer;
begin
edit2.Text:=edit2.Text + '+';
edit1.Text:=edit3.Text ;
edit3.Text:='';
end;

procedure TForm1.Button12Click(Sender: TObject);
var a,b,c:single;
begin
a:=strtofloat(edit1.Text);
b:=strtofloat(edit3.Text);

if Edit2.Text = '+' then
begin
b := a + b;
edit3.Text :=floattostr(b);
end

Else if Edit2.Text = '-' then
begin
b := a - b ;
edit3.Text :=floattostr(b);
end
Else if Edit2.Text = 'x' then
begin
b := a * b;
edit3.Text :=floattostr(b);
end
Else if Edit2.Text = ':' then
begin
b := a / b;
edit3.Text :=floattostr(b);
end;


end;

procedure TForm1.Button13Click(Sender: TObject);
begin
edit1.Text:='';
edit2.Text:='';
edit3.Text:='';
edit1.SetFocus;
end;

procedure TForm1.Button14Click(Sender: TObject);
begin
edit2.Text:=edit2.Text + 'x';
edit1.Text:=edit3.Text ;
edit3.Text:='';
end;

procedure TForm1.Button15Click(Sender: TObject);
begin
edit2.Text:=edit2.Text + ':';
edit1.Text:=edit3.Text ;
edit3.Text:='';
end;

procedure TForm1.Button16Click(Sender: TObject);
begin
edit2.Text:=edit2.Text + '-';
edit1.Text:=edit3.Text ;
edit3.Text:='';
end;

procedure TForm1.Button1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'1';
end;

procedure TForm1.Button2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'2';
end;

procedure TForm1.Button3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'3';
end;

procedure TForm1.Button4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'4';
end;

procedure TForm1.Button5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'5';
end;

procedure TForm1.Button6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'6';
end;

procedure TForm1.Button7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'7';
end;

procedure TForm1.Button8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'8';
end;

procedure TForm1.Button9Click(Sender: TObject);
begin
edit3.Text:=edit3.Text + '9';
end;

end.





*************************Selamat mencoba********************************************

0 komentar:

Posting Komentar

desain dan isi milik Bonaventura @Right 2008. Diberdayakan oleh Blogger.